Usually, they work like this: You fill the clean tank with hot tap water and cleaning solution; rest the machine on the ground near the stain; squeeze a trigger on the hose to squirt the liquid onto the stain through a small, low-pressure nozzle near the brush; and scrub the stain while the vacuum sucks up the moisture and dirt into the waste tank. Gunk may build up throughout the tanks, hose, and even parts (like the suction gate leading into the dirty-water tank). The tanks usually have a tiny opening (about the size of the mouth on a gallon jug of milk), so you cant simply reach in with a cloth and wipe everything down (a bottle brush wouldnt be that helpful either). We stained a medium-pile, cream-colored area rug with a bevy of stains thatbased on our experience creating stains to test laundry detergents and other cleaning productswe thought would be hard to clean.
